Ways to Prevent 'Home Business Burnout'

As a Work from Home Business proprietor, there is a very good chance that you realize why avoiding "home business burn out" is so important. You may have already been concious of the need to maintain your energy levels and reduce your stress levels while you were involved in your other employment. It is important to remember that a little stress can be a good thing and can actually help you be more productive. After all, you rarely, if ever, see a top athlete who is fully relaxed before an important event. When stress becomes overwhelming, however, we have to deal with it.

Many people learn from their life experience to pace themseles, consume vitamin-rich foods, exercise and get sufficient sleep( at least 6-7 hours in every 24 hr. period). But while these steps are vital at every stage of life, they are even more crucial you first launch your business because the mental and physical strains are most severe during this time frame. When you were an employee, you may have been accustomed to a specific job and therefore left other details to others. But a work-from-home business will generally demand a broader spectrum of responsibilities than that. Much like a movie actor who decides to direct the film as well, the home-based business entrepreneur must rise to the occasion, and often with thire life savings on the line and very few benefits.

To help prevent the stress that may ultimately lead to burnout, there are some things that may help. The most important of them may be your overall attitude. Try not to make a mountain out of a molehill. As you set out on your new path, mistakes are bound to occur. Be ready for them and even embrace them because they are simply a part of the learning and growing process. Errors usually mean you are learning something new, regardless of what you learned about mistakes in school. Don't make a bigger issue out of errors than you have to. The same goes for incidents that seem to be a result of "bad luck". In these trying situations it is all too easy to think that you are being victimized but do not fall into the trap of making these incidents worse than they are because they also happen to every home business proprietor at some point or another along the way.

It is essential to eat healthy food whenever you can. If you attempt to subsist on coffee and Krispy Kremes you will probably reach burnout at some point. Your body and mind require adequate nutrition to combat the pressure of running your own business venture so refrain from burning the candle at both ends. Antioxidants may help in this regard. Vitamin C and E are perhaps most helpful. You also will need plenty of fluids. Dehydration is common in these scenarios. Also make certain to make time for R & R. Anything that diverts your mind for a just few hours may be of assistance. Simply seeing a movie may help alleviate the stress somewhat. But you also will require to a regular vacation as well so do not neglect to plan for this.

One thing that can definately help you fell more relaxed is using heavy breathing. Just breathe in slowly for a count of seven and then breathe out for a count of eleven. You can also protect yourself from stress by recognising stress in other people and limiting your contact with them as much as possible.
